Tigers put on show
Stealing spree thwarted
By ANEEKA SIMONIS RICHMOND Football Club will put on a show for Cardinia Shire residents as they take to a Pakenham reserve for a highly anticipated training session ahead of the Australia Day long weekend. The Tigers will train at Toomuc Recreation Reserve from 4.30pm on Friday 23 January which will be followed by a free kids’ football clinic led by the Richmond players. Diehard fans will also have a chance of meeting their favourite players after their twilight training session. The event is expected to draw a massive crowd that will build on the numbers that swarmed the team’s training session at Holm Park Reserve in Beaconsfield last year. In addition to watching the team train, kids and families can enjoy a range of other activities including inflatables, face-painting, giveaways and prizes to be won. The Parklea-supported event will provide food and drinks for purchase as well as onsite parking, merchandise and membership offers.
FOUR youths were caught red-handed during a botched stealing spree in Pakenham over the weekend. An 11-year-old Pakenham boy was the youngest of the four netted by police for stealing from Target, Coles, Woolworths, Big W and Caltex in Main Street on Saturday 11 January. A 20-year-old Pakenham woman, along with two men aged 18 and 22 from St Kilda, were charged on bail while the 11-year-old was issued with a caution and ordered to take part in youth diversion programs. “Once kids start in a cycle of crime, they continue to offend. We try to intervene as soon as possible to help prevent them continuing down that path,” Pakenham Senior Sergeant Nathan Prowd said.

OVERALL crime dropped in the Pakenham area in the lead-up to Christmas. Pakenham police Acting Sergeant Ryan Murnane reported at a Neighbourhood Watch Cardinia meeting on 18 December that crime reports had dropped from 71 to 56 over the past month. Theft of motor vehicles (14 down from 20) and property damage (10 down from 15) underpinned the drop in crime. However, burglaries (16 up from 11), general thefts (eight up from four) and shop steals (five up from two) all increased. There was also a small increase in theft of motor vehicles.

Driver jailed after crashing into train By CASEY NEILL A TRUCK driver will spend up to five years in jail over a fatal Dandenong South train crash. Supreme Court of Victoria Justice Lex Lasry on 18 December sentenced Melville Bollen, 71, to five years in jail, with a minimum two years and six months, over the 3 November 2012 incident at Abbotts Road. Bollen, formerly of Narre Warren North, drove his semi-trailer through lowered boom gates and
collided with the six-carriage Cranbourne-bound train about 11.40am. Cranbourne West man David Cron, 43, died from head and chest injuries at the scene and four other passengers were injured. Train driver Trevor King suffered a brain injury and fractures to his ribs, hands and feet. Victim impact statements indicated that other passengers now feared using public transport and had increased anxiety about bad things happening to them or their family, flashbacks and nightmares.
Bollen pleaded guilty to culpable driving and multiple charges of negligently causing serious injury. He’d been a professional driver for almost 50 years and was not speeding at the time of the crash. “For the whole of your working life, your attitude to your driving has been responsible,” Justice Lasry said. Witnesses said Bollen was looking downwards as he approached the crossing, looked up and realised the situation at the last moment, and tried to brake and steer around the

boom gates. “The fact that you were distracted for as long as 19 seconds naturally makes this a very serious offence,” Justice Lasry said. “It is certain you were not paying anywhere near the attention to your driving that you should have been.” He said he was confident that Bollen would “live a law-abiding life once you are released”. Justice Lasry also cancelled his licence and disqualified him from obtaining a licence for five years.

Labor win tick By LACHLAN MOORHEAD CASEY is among the seven south-eastern councils which have welcomed the arrival of the new Victorian Government, with Labor having made a string of election promises for the municipality. South East Melbourne (SEM) Chair and City of Frankston Mayor Sandra Mayer said her council coalition had been monitoring and assessing Labor’s election pledges against regional priorities during the election campaign and was pleased with the initial results. “We are encouraged by the fact that many of the commitments made are consistent with our regional priorities and we look forward to sitting down with the new government to discuss exactly how and when
each promise will be delivered,” she said. Labor’s election promises regarding the City of Casey include the removal of the Hallam and Berwick railway crossings, for which funding has already been confirmed, and a $5 million upgrade of Hampton Park Primary School. The State Government has also pledged to install public toilets at Hallam station, and promised a $175 million duplication of Thompsons Road, in addition to a $106 million upgrade of Casey Hospital. “We’ll also be seeking to learn more about how SEM communities will benefit from broader state-wide commitments including the Back to Work program, aimed at creating 100,000 jobs and the plan for Fairer, Safer Housing,” Ms Mayer said.
She also said the southeast councils were in the final stages of developing their first regional plan and would be seeking commitments from regional MPs during the coming months. “While we are grateful for all of these important announcements, there is much more to be done to ensure that we are ready to respond to the long-term challenges and opportunities our region is expected to face,” Ms Mayer said. “These include creating and attracting more local jobs to respond to increasing population growth, building the necessary infrastructure to accommodate growing communities, developing our freight and logistics network to support economic growth and improving public transport.”

Cruelty to bird By LACHLAN MOORHEAD A 19-YEAR-OLD from Narre Warren was charged on summons last month after a bird was shot with an arrow at Wilson’s Promontory. The teenager was charged with aggravated cruelty following the incident in which the bird was shot at Shallow Inlet, in Wilson Promontory National Park, on Sunday 28 December. The bird has still not been located by authorities.
Wildlife Victoria spokeswoman Amy Amato said there had been an increase over summer of animals being impaled by objects - many of which appeared intentional. “We’re getting lots of calls about this sort of thing,” she said. “It’s been a reoccurrence over the last month or so, this holiday period we’ve seen an increase in these types of incidents. “Whether people are just on
holidays and it’s turning into this, I don’t know.” Ms Amato said the recently recorded incidents included the use of items such as “spear-like devices” and kebab skewers. “It’s absolutely despicable, it’s disgusting what people can do to an innocent animal,” Ms Amato said. Anyone with any information is urged to contact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000, or Wildlife Victoria on 1300 094 535.

Complaint ends By LACHLAN MOORHEAD COUNCILLOR Rosalie Crestani has withdrawn her discrimination complaint with the Equal Opportunity Commission against Casey’s Mayor and CEO. Cr Crestani announced last Tuesday that she would be withdrawing her complaints against City of Casey Mayor Mick Morland and CEO Mike Tyler that she had lodged with both the Commission and the Councillor Code of Conduct Panel. Cr Crestani demanded last year that Casey Mayor Mick Morland resign from his position after she was prevented from raising an amendment to stop the council from promoting same-sex relationships. Cr Crestani has now said she would be withdrawing the complaints after a
“great deal of soul searching” and would no longer seek the mayor’s resignation. “I have come to realise what I had set out to achieve in representing the public interest has since veered from the path that I feel is beneficial to all the parties involved,” she said. “My heart is to work in conjunction with my colleagues to achieve greater outcomes for our residents.” Cr Crestani’s fellow Four Oaks Ward councillor Rafal Kaplon came out publicly as gay in November after she attempted to raise the motion to stop the City of Casey promoting awareness of different sexual orientations. Cr Crestani’s motion sought to stop the council from issuing media releases and remove signs concerning sexual ori-
entation or the l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ender and intersex (LGBTI) community. Cr Crestani, who was a candidate for the Rise Up Australia Party (RUAP) in the Victorian election, also sought to abolish the council’s LGBTI diversity training program. Cr Crestani was removed from her role on a number of council committees after last year’s acrimony. Cr Morland, who met with her last Wednesday, said it would be a whole council decision as to whether Ms Crestani was ever re-admitted onto the committees. The first ordinary council meeting for 2015 will take place on Tuesday 20 January.

Students again on uni honours board By LACHLAN MOORHEAD A CRANBOURNE high school has won a prestigious university competition for the second year in a row. Cranbourne East Secondary College was crowned the winner of the 2014 Monash University Casey Challenge event in December, having also claimed the honours in 2013. Now in its second year, the challenge provides Year 9 and 10 students from across Casey with the opportunity to experience university life by attending lectures, touring the grounds and working on assignments at Monash’s Berwick campus. This year more than 80 students took part in the initiative from schools including Alkira, Cranbourne East, Narre Warren South P-12 and Maranatha Secondary Colleges. Mayor Mick Morland congratulated the Cranbourne East Secondary College students who claimed the top prize for their assignment project. “The judges commended Cranbourne East for their creativity, in-depth research and great teamwork to produce a
great assignment,” he said. “The winning students were presented with gift cards and a perpetual cup, which will reside with the winning school for the next year.” Cr Morland said the awards ceremony was held to celebrate the challenge program’s success. “In conjunction with Monash University, the City of Casey designed this program to provide further opportunities for young people to explore pathways into tertiary education,” he said. “Students in this region have significantly lower levels of tertiary education than greater Melbourne and this project was designed to expose students to what university would be like in the hope of raising their aspiration levels. “This program is especially beneficial for students who may not have considered university as an option for them and now see it as a future goal.” The challenge ran for six weeks and students were able to experience university life with the help of tertiary students.
Safety fears close bridge A TREACHEROUS bridge in Narre Warren which has been judged too dangerous to drive on has been temporarily closed. The City of Casey has closed the Troups Creek bridge crossing at Fox Road in Narre Warren North, between Leech Court and Roy Close, in the interest of community safety. It will remain closed until further notice. Casey Mayor Mick Morland said the bridge had been shut as a “precaution to motorists” following the “recent deterioration of the road and bridge”. “Council has inspected the bridge and significant repairs are required,” he said. “As a result, the bridge crossing will need to remain closed until the necessary works are complete, to ensure public safety. “Rectification works are still at the design stage and it is too early to advise when the road will re-open.” Mayor Morland said the council will estimate a completion timeframe for the bridge once the new design had been finalised. “While council is working to re-open the road as soon as possible, the safety of road users remains council’s number one priority,” he said. “We apologise for any inconvenience that may be caused and we will continue to keep you updated on the progress of these works and how long the road will be closed.” For further information, contact the City of Casey Customer Service on 9705 5200.

RENOVATE OR RELOCATE HAS ITS PROS AND CONS WHEN your kids are demanding their own bedrooms, that old-fashioned kitchen is getting on your nerves or your house needs a major overhaul, a difficult decision awaits - to renovate or relocate. Renovating an existing home offers the chance to create the house you want in the location you know and like. It avoids upheavals such as changing children’s schools or settling into a new community. But the difficulties are obvious - the disruption, the need to temporarily rent or live in a building site, the expense and potential for cost overruns, the work involved in planning
permissions, design and project management. Buying a new home may seem easier but it brings its own challenges, not least of which is finding the ideal home in your preferred location. As well, it entails selling your existing home for the right price and co-ordinating moving from one to the other, preferably without renting in the interim. Start by asking yourself what you want most - is it to stay in your current location and to to live in a home which meets all your requirements and fulfils the wish list you have been compiling for all those years?
DISPLAY & LAND
If the answer is yes, ask yourself whether all the downsides of a major renovation - from potentially months with no kitchen and/or bathroom to choosing everything from light fittings to drawer handles - are worth it to achieve your location and dream home goals. If you decide that the end result is worth it, start interviewing architects to obtain costs for your renovation and ensure that what you want is achievable with the funds you have. Thoroughly analyse your finances, including meeting with your bank manager and accountant, to ensure you can raise
those funds, plus contingency. It is also time to talk to a local real estate agent to ensure you will not be overcapitalising your home. If the cost of your renovation will take the amount spent on your home above the ceiling price for homes in your area, it may be time to rethink. Even if you plan to stay long term, assuming you will eventually be in profit, overcapitalising is not a good idea. Sometimes selling unexpectedly is necessary and if the house is overcapitalised, you may lose money. If you think the upheaval of a renovation is not justified, or you are undecided about it, an estate agent can help.

Ex-Eagle wants to love it By DAVID NAGEL
Former West Coast Eagle Ashley Smith will play for the Berwick Football Club in the inaugural South East Football League season in 2015. 133021 Picture: WEST COAST EAGLES
DELISTED West Coast Eagle Ash Smith is simply looking forward to enjoying his footy again after signing with the Berwick Football Club for 2015. A Berwick junior from age 12, the 24-year-old midfielder has returned home after six years with the Eagles where he played 45 games before being delisted at the end of the 2014 season. Smith said he was excited about the move home and the opportunity to play footy again without coping with the relentless pressure associated with being an AFL player. “I’m pretty excited about going back to Berwick to be honest,” the 36 draft pick in the 2008 National Draft said.
“For me now, after being in the AFL system for quite a few years it’s about fun and just getting back to enjoying my footy again. To play with blokes like Madi Andrews, who I’ve played with in the past, and to play against a few other blokes that I know from around the area is going to be very enjoyable.” Smith said he had no ambition to get back into the cut and thrust of AFL football and would instead concentrate on helping the Wickers improve on last year’s fourth placing. “No not really, I just think people don’t understand how much you go through and how demanding it is to be an AFL player these days,” he said. “I trained with Richmond in the
off-season and I could have gone and played at VFL level, but I’ll be 25 by the next draft and there are no guarantees at that age. This wasn’t always in the plan, but in the end it just felt right to come back. Bruce Andrews approached me shortly after I was delisted and it just seemed like the perfect fit. “Berwick’s a club that has always been around the mark but just can’t quite get across the line. They’re all good guys at the club and at the age where we should really be setting our sights high.” The former Dandenong Stingray said he was also looking forward to working with senior coach Rhys Nisbet to develop the club’s core group of youngsters. “I’ve only spoken with Rhys
a couple of times but from that I can already tell he’s very keen, very dedicated and very enthusiastic about getting the best out of the group, particularly the younger players,” he said. “I’m looking forward to that development side of things as well, and teaching the young blokes what’s required and how hard you have to train if you want to get the best out of yourself. “There are some things you just can’t learn or appreciate until you’ve been at an AFL club and I’m Iooking forward to passing some of those things on to the youngsters.” Ash’s brother Aaron, who Ash describes as a really talented player who hasn’t played for a while, will also join the club.

Covering up from the sun THIS picture shows a man with multiple areas of advanced sun damage and squamous cell cancers of the scalp due to prolonged sun exposure over many years. He has multiple surgical treatments ahead of him. Squamous cell cancers at this site can spread to the local lymph glands in the neck and require radiotherapy. Several hundred people in Australia die of squamous cell cancer of the skin every year. Such outcomes can be avoided simply by habitually wearing a hat in the sun. Clothes are good for you! Please wear them. Seek the shade and cover up as much as you can outdoors and apply SPF30 + or SPF50+ sun block to any exposed areas of skin which are uncovered by clothing. Wise words bring award By JARROD POTTER LOVE of cricket runs deeply within John Wise. Wise, 53, from Berwick Springs is virtually inseparable from the cricket ovals around the state each summer and throws himself into any role to help his beloved clubs Berwick Springs and formerly Salesian Old Boys - become stronger. This passion for chipping in and ensuring the next generation flourishes earned him Cricket Victoria recognition as one of 20 volunteers at the Boxing Day Test for his contributions to the summer sport. “It’s a huge honour - you don’t do it for the recognition or for an award like that,” Wise said. “For me I’ve got a lot out of cricket - playing at two clubs Salesian Old Boys and Berwick Springs - and in 40-odd years involvement in club cricket I’ve just enjoyed every minute of it. “To be recognised is a big thrill and I was just blown away - I just love the involvement in the game, love being around the club and I think it’s good for young people to be involved in the club environment.” No matter where he’s gone in life, since 12 years old, Wise has always been drawn a cricket club nearby and wouldn’t have it any other way. He played most of his career
at Salesian Old Boys Cricket Club in Chadstone but the bowling all-rounder shifted to Berwick Springs and signed up with the Titans soon after. After 36 years at Salesian Old Boys, the shift to Berwick Springs has been just as joyous for the Wise family - his wife Anne Maree, son Sam and daughter Antonia. As all great volunteers usually are, the long-time cricket administrator/coach/player is particularly humble about his achievements, but there are a lot of stellar achievements on his resume. “I play a small part in Berwick Springs,” Wise said. “There are a lot of great people in Berwick Springs and I was fortunate enough to receive the award and I’m absolutely stoked - it’s great to have this recognition across two clubs I hold dearly. “Both clubs are fantastic and I’ve made some great friendships through cricket and that’s one thing the young people will definitely get out of team sport as those friendships stay for life.” Wise will look back fondly on his role helping Berwick Springs receive a turf wicket upgrade to Berwick Springs Reserve, allowing the Titans for the first time in 2015/16 to compete in the Dandenong Dis-
trict Cricket Association’s turf divisions. Another proud achievement in his coaching career was guiding Hawthorn-Monash Women’s Cricket Club to a premiership and also one for Berwick Springs - the club’s first flag - in 2011/12. He also thinks cultivating the next generation of Titans talent is just as important for the departing president. “My main goal - the goal with the club - would be to get a turf wicket put in the reserve,” Wise said. “That was my mission and to make sure we got that turf wicket and with a lot of assistance from the City of Casey they’ve made a dream of the club come true. “We’ll have a turf wicket to play on next year and that will help keep our kids at the club and that’s what I want to see.” He had to step aside from the Berwick Springs CC presidency to devote more time to his family and his business Universal Cleaning Group - but rest assured he will never be far away from the sport he loves. Wise can be found most weekends in the blue and green Titan colours or out in the centre wearing the whites as he fills in wherever he can in the Berwick Springs’ D, E or F Grade teams.

Battle win warms the hearts By LACHLAN MOORHEAD A CASEY-based band has a bright future, if winning the Battle of the Bands is anything to go by. The Evercold turned up the heat when it competed in the regional FReeZA Push Start Battle of the Bands last month, winning the competition for the City of Casey held at the Cranbourne Public Hall. The Evercold competed against five other bands from a range of municipalities, including Stridor which represented the City of Kingston, Bloomfield which represented the City of Stonnington, Melanie Grace which represented the Frankston City Council, Beneath the Lies which represented the Bayside City Council, and Manor which represented the City of Greater Dandenong. In addition to receiving first place in the competition, The Evercold also took out the Audience Choice award while Bloomfield came second and Stridor was third. Casey Mayor Mick Morland commended The
Evercold for taking out the top prize, noting that it had made the City of Casey very proud. “All of the bands were very talented and entertained the crowd, making it hard for the judging panel to pick the winners,” he said. “It was great to see a local band win and showcase the amazing talent we have here in Casey. “Congratulations to all competitors on their performances and I wish them all the best of luck with their future successes - I’m sure they will all go on to have great careers in the music industry. The Evercold will now go on to represent Casey and the Southern Metropolitan Region at the FReeZA Push Start State Grand Final, which will be held at Moomba on Saturday 7 March. For more information on FReeZA events in Casey, contact City of Casey Customer Service on 9705 5200 or visit www.casey.vic.gov.au/ youth.

Coach laps up challenge By JARROD POTTER A DECADE in to his time as Casey TigerSharks Swimming Club’s head coach Ben Hiddlestone is still striving to reach the next level and push the club even further. Arriving at the City of Casey based swimming club in December 2004, Hiddlestone from Berwick has become a mainstay in Victorian swimming circles ever since and helped cultivate one of the strongest programs in the state. He knows a thing or two about coaching longevity having learned the craft under his mentor Miami Swimming Club’s (Queensland) coach Denis Cotterell who is about to notch his 40th year at the club. From when he started, a club without much state level success let alone international representation, the TigerSharks have blossomed under Hiddlestone’s guidance to now boasts 170 swimmers in its midst from six-yearolds through to Olympic and Commonwealth Games representatives. Hiddlestone was pleased to accomplish the milestone and see the club develop in both results and membership through the past decade. “It was really good - it was around December (10 year anniversary) I think it was so just a couple of weeks ago,” Hiddlestone said. “It’s been great journey, I suppose, and I did feel it was a big milestone and it was a big deal just personally and internally that you stay somewhere for 10 years. “You also have some results and seeing swimmers grow and your club going through issues and you survive those, so it has a bit of an effect at the
Ben Hiddlestone, centre, pictured here with Josh Beaver, left, and Matson Lawson recently celebrated 10 years as Casey TigerSharks swimming head coach. Picture: SUPPLIED end of it.” The three defining moments that stand out to the TigerSharks coach across his time at the helm have been Matson Lawson earning a place on the London 2012 Olympic Games
team - the first TigerShark to make an international senior team - Josh Beaver earning three medals at last year’s Commonwealth Games and the creation of the Casey RACE swimming pool and the effect it is having on the Cranbourne area and its swimmers.
“Putting Matson on the Olympic team - that was a big deal for me as a coach,” Hiddlestone said. “The second one was Beaver’s results at the Commonwealth Games his three medals - as he was one of the
only kids that were at the club when I got there 10 years ago. “Then the new pool at Casey RACE - I got there when the old Cranbourne pool next to the racetrack was still going and they built Casey ARC then maybe thinking about building the pool in Cranbourne. “Getting that up and running three or four years ago that has really changed the club as well.” The growth of the club has enabled Hiddlestone to stay in the suburbs and not pursue opportunities at one of the inner city clubs and create a program the metropolitan teams would envy. “As coaches grow, if the Casey TigerSharks didn’t have the lane space for me to have an elite program, I probably would have moved into one of the city clubs,” Hiddlestone said. “But it just so happens that the work that I’ve done and the club has done has enabled the club to grow at the same rate and can offer a little kiddies program and a big, elite program which allows me to stay and grow here as well.” The future for Hiddlestone is to keep pushing the next generation of Australian elite swimmers through and hopefully generate enough international success to enable the Casey TigerSharks to become a Swimming Australia Podium centre - the highest funding and support level from the national body. For now it’s back to the pool-deck for early sessions as Hiddlestone and the TigerSharks prepare for the Swimming Victoria Open Championships which are to be held at MSAC from 16 to 18 January.

PAKENHAM Floorball Club will host the best of the Asia Pacific’s female teams for the Women’s World Floorball Championships Qualifications this month. The Asia Pacific tournament qualifiers, running from 23-25 January at Pakenham’s Cardinia LIFE, will see Team Australia vie against Japan, Singapore and New Zealand for a chance to book a spot in the World Cup later this year. The Squishees have three club members in the Australian team - Kayleigh Tribe, Freya Carson and Ash Bourke - who will fight their hardest to qualify for the World Cup in Tampere, Finland, this upcoming December. The three best teams out of the four will qualify for the international tournament with Australia’s matches scheduled for 3.15pm Friday (Japan), 3pm Saturday (New Zealand) and 3.15pm Sunday (Singapore). The opening ceremony on the morning of Friday 23 January also includes The Choir of
Pakenham floorball trio Kayleigh Tribe, Freya Carson and Ash Bourke are ready to take on the rest of Asia Pacific at the upcoming World Floorball Championships Qualifications at Cardinia LIFE. 133008 Picture: SUPPLIED Hard Knocks and a local dance troupe, with an opening welcome by the local Indigenous Elder Aunty. It caps off a stellar few months for the club as a number of Pakenham’s men’s team competed at the 10th IFF World Floorball Championships in Gothenburg, Sweden, in December. James Parnall, Brad King,
Gavin Staindl, Jeremy Monckton, Paul Hogg and Raymond Staindl took to the field for Australia and the Aussies excelled, beating Russia in their first game to create the upset of the tournament. Australia won two of their five matches to finish 14th overall, while Monckton was named best on court for Australia twice at the championships.

Lions pride roars again By DAVID NAGEL PAKENHAM (2/83) has closed the gap between itself and the top-four teams in the WGCA Premier Division with a crunching victory over Emerald (82) at Toomuc Reserve on Saturday. The fifth-placed Lions pushed their stuttering start to the season aside, toying with the Bombers to close within three games of third and fourth placed Merinda Park and Tooradin respectively. The Lions could hardly have been more impressive, with Russ Lehman (3/5), Shannon Mitchell (3/25) and Jack Ryan (2/22) bowling beautifully, before Chris Smith (41 not out) and Bradey Welsh (29) completed the most clinical of victories. The win sets up one of the games of the season this Saturday, where the Lions take on Merinda Park, under lights at Toomuc Reserve, in a replay of last year’s thriller that ended in a tie. Stand-in skipper Jack Anning said there was still much to look forward to for the Lions after their most impressive win for the season. “It makes for an exciting finish doesn’t it,” Anning said after Saturday’s win. “We’ve got Merinda Park, then Cardinia, which will be a really tough game, then Beaconsfield and Upper Beaconsfield and then we finish off with Kooweerup. There’s no doubt we’ve put ourselves in a tough position, but we’d back ourselves to win all of those games if we can produce our best cricket, and that’s what we need to do if we want to play finals.” Upper Beaconsfield (0/106) has produced the upset of the West Gippsland Premier Division season, crushing premiership fancy Tooradin (105) by 10 wickets at Upper Beaconsfield on Saturday. The Maroons’ eyebrow raising
WGCA
Pakenham fire-brand Jack Ryan has been in terrific form of late and continued to impress taking 2/22 Picture: STEWART CHAMBERS against Emerald on Saturday. 132891 performance has kept the top-flight season alive, with Pakenham joining them as teams outside the top four still searching for a finals berth. Maroons’ skipper Chris Savage threw the new-ball to off-spinner Rob North and the momentum immediately swung the Maroons’ way. Sure, they didn’t get wickets immediately, but North (0/9 off 3), Jayden Joyce (2/24 off 6) and 15-year-old gun Chad McDonald (1/9 off 4) gave their skipper exactly what he had asked for. “It was all about not letting blokes like Huss (Tom Hussey) get away from us early,” Savage said. “We didn’t get a wicket until they were 24 but, to tell you the truth, they never looked comfortable, and I was really impressed with the way our boys bowled.” And the wickets soon came, Joyce, McDonald, Tommy Tyrrell (2/22 off 8) and Will Haines (2/14 off 7) combining to devastate the visitors, who lost 7/36 in a rare display of vulnerability. Ross Douglas
(21) and Jarred Thompson (13) did some repair work on the innings, but that was unstitched by Kyle Gibbs (3/13 off 5) who claimed the last three wickets to fall. Regular opener North (26 not out) was then joined by Tyrrell (64 not out) and they produced the most surprising century partnership of the season, pulverising the Seagulls’ attack to reverse the result of a round six drubbing. “We had a massive point to prove after what they did to us last time, just like we will have against Cardinia next week, so it was great to see the boys respond the way they did,” Savage said. “I definitely think we’re good enough to win four of our next five games.” Cardinia (154) continued its dominant season, remaining unbeaten and putting Merinda Park (128) back in its place with a 26-run win at Gunton Oval. The experienced trio of Neil Barfuss (53), Simon Parrott (29) and Ben Darose (21) led the charge with
the bat for the Bulls against a Dylan Cuthbertson (4/28) inspired Cobras’ attack. Cuthbertson (59 not out) then played a lone hand as Dean Henwood (3/10 off 8) and Barfuss (3/18 off 6) produced another near perfect display with the cherry. Reigning champs Kooweerup (127) survived a scare against the winless Beaconsfield (105) at Perc Allison Oval. Matt Davey (43) and Dananja Madushanka (18 not out) rescued the Demons from a precarious 6/40, after Shameera Weerasinghe (3/25 off 8) and Ricahrd Gault (3/21 off 5) had done the early damage. The Demons bowling is spot on at the moment, and Ron Bright Jr (3/19 off 6.3), John Bright (2/16 off 8) and Davey (2/20 off 8) shook their team free of danger to chalk up their fifth win on the trot. Weerasinghe (27) and Brett Monagle (22) almost had the Tigers across the line ... but just lacked support.
